Clinical thermometer

“Touch” is a new type of fever thermometer based on the way that a mother touches a child’s forehead to find out whether or not the child has a fever. It is much more convenient to use than regular thermometers, which already make you feel like you are sick. You simply slip it onto your hand and the child doesn’t even have to know that you are using it.

JURY STATEMENT

Design for living - selected by Charles O. Job A mother's caring touch is not only soothing. The touch is enough to gauge the temperature of a poorly child.
